Sodexo Q1 Fiscal 2026 revenues in line with expectations

Revenue Summary - Total consolidated revenues for Q1 Fiscal 2026 amounted to 6.3 billion euros, reflecting an organic revenue growth of +1.8% compared to Q1 Fiscal 2025 [7][14] - The revenue growth was negatively impacted by a currency effect of -4.0%, primarily due to the depreciation of the U.S. dollar against the euro [7][22] - By region, North America experienced a decline in organic growth of -1.5%, Europe saw an increase of +2.4%, and the Rest of the World achieved a significant growth of +10.2% [7][15] Regional Performance - In North America, revenues totaled 2.9 billion euros, with notable declines in Business & Administration (-7.6%) and Education (-3.6%), while Healthcare & Seniors grew by +4.4% [16] - Europe generated 2.3 billion euros in revenue, with Business & Administration growing by +2.8% and Healthcare & Seniors by +5.4%, despite a decline in Sodexo Live! [19] - The Rest of the World reported revenues of 1.1 billion euros, driven by strong performances in Australia, India, Brazil, and Chile, with Business & Administration growing by +9.6% [20] Operational Priorities and Outlook - The company aims to enhance client centricity, invest in personnel, and improve operational efficiency as part of its strategic priorities [4][11] - Fiscal 2026 guidance remains unchanged, with organic revenue growth expected between +1.5% and +2.5%, and a slight decrease in underlying operating profit margin compared to Fiscal 2025 [6][11] - Planned investments in technology and targeted initiatives in U.S. Education are underway to support medium-term performance [8][11] Leadership and Sustainability - Thierry Delaporte, the new CEO, has taken direct leadership of North America to drive performance in the region [11] - Sodexo has been recognized on CDP's A-List for climate performance, highlighting its commitment to sustainability and transparency [11][13]
